The Paper Catalog is Dead: Why You Should Be Using a B2B Sales Portal

 

In the past, buyers often found themselves at their desks, sifting through piles of paper catalogs to locate a specific product. They would painstakingly fill out order forms by hand, hoping they had noted the product number correctly, or endure long waits on the phone, accompanied by elevator music, as they held for a sales representative. Fortunately, those days are behind us. The internet has revolutionized the way we find products, allowing us to not only locate them with ease but also evaluate, check availability, and place orders with just a few clicks. What to Look for in Order Management Software

If your staff is spending more than an hour or two a day entering orders or answering routine questions from sales reps and wholesale customers, then you should consider getting them some order management software with an online sales rep and wholesale customer portal. The more time your employees spend on mundane tasks, the less time they spend on activities that will help the business thrive.

B2B portals that let your reps and customers place orders and answer their own questions 24/7 will save you time and increase customer satisfaction by giving them instant access to the info they need.
